Zusammenfassung:The invention relates to a rear group adjusting video shooting high-definition zoom lens and a rear group adjusting method for the lens. The lens comprises a front fixed lens group with a positive focal length, a zoom lens group with a negative focal length, a compensating lens group with a positive or negative focal length, a diaphragm and a rear fixed lens group with a positive focal length, and the front fixed lens group, the zoom lens group, the compensating lens group, the diaphragm and the rear fixed lens group are arranged on a main optical shaft in order in light incident direction. The lens also comprises a rear adjusting lens group located between the rear fixed lens group and an image surface. The rear adjusting lens group has a positive focal length and can move back and forth between the rear fixed lens group and the image plane to adjust an image formed by an object when an object distance is changed and thus the image shown in the image plane position is clear. The zoom lens group and the compensating lens group are in linkage connection and achieve change of the lens focal length. In the method, a focal length is adjusted through the rear adjusting lens group. Better image quality can be obtained in a near distance when the provided method is compared with a front group adjusting method. During the focusing process, the caliber of the lens front group is not changed, the whole length of the lens is not changed, and the combined focal length of the lens is not changed basically.
